Well I've had trouble free running for a good while now until a rattling noise has appeared coming from my gear selector and only when in 5th.
The noise dissappears if I put my hand or even just ever so slightly apply pressure to it.
As I say it's only when selected in 5th gear.
Any ideas ??

It'll be wear in the 5th gear selector shaft bearing and the selector fork itself rattling maybe - they are actually prone to wearing these parts out from what I've read, if you or someone before you, drive with your hand on the shifter in 5th. That part of the gearbox can be replaced. Salvage Rebuilds UK have done something similar on video via YouTube.
